Where to Meet New People in Cambridge, MA
1. Harvard Square - This bustling area is a popular spot for people to gather and socialize. With its variety of shops, restaurants, and street performers, there is always something happening in Harvard Square.
2. Kendall Square - Known as the "innovation hub" of Cambridge, Kendall Square is home to numerous tech companies, startups, and research institutions. It's also a popular spot for networking events and conferences, making it an ideal place for professionals to socialize.
3. Charles River Esplanade - Located along the banks of the Charles River, this scenic park offers beautiful views of the city skyline and is a popular spot for outdoor activities and social gatherings, such as picnics and concerts.
4. Central Square - This diverse and vibrant neighborhood is known for its lively nightlife scene, with a variety of bars, restaurants, and live music venues. It's a popular spot for locals and visitors alike to gather and socialize.
5. MIT Campus - The Massachusetts Institute of Technology is not only a prestigious university, but also a hub for socializing. The campus offers a variety of events, clubs, and activities for students and faculty to connect and socialize.

FAQ about Cambridge, MA
1. What is the population of Cambridge, MA?
Answer: As of 2021, the estimated population of Cambridge, MA is around 118,927.
2. What is the weather like in Cambridge?
Answer: Cambridge has a humid continental climate with warm summers and cold winters. The average temperature in summer is around 80°F and in winter it can drop to 30°F.
3. What is the cost of living in Cambridge?
Answer: The cost of living in Cambridge is considered to be high, with the average cost of rent being around $2,500 per month and the average cost of a home being over $1 million.
4. What are some popular attractions in Cambridge?
Answer: Some popular attractions in Cambridge include Harvard University, MIT, Harvard Square, and the Charles River.
